1PCS Sensors Switch EE-SX672 EE-SX672A EE-SX672P Sensor Slotted Optical

1PCS Sensors Switch EE-SX672 EE-SX672A EE-SX672P Sensor Slotted Optical
sku: 1005005439681294
$3.40
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ed